O'Ceallaigh Surname
Approximately 190 people bear this surname
O'Ceallaigh Surname User-submission:
O'Ceallaigh is a surname of Irish origin, derived from the word ceallach, meaning 'bright headed' or 'frequent churches'.

How Common Is The Last Name O'Ceallaigh? popularity and diffusion
This surname is the 1,227,038th most common last name on a worldwide basis, held by around 1 in 38,355,505 people. The surname O'Ceallaigh is primarily found in Europe, where 93 percent of O'Ceallaigh reside; 92 percent reside in Northern Europe and 92 percent reside in British Isles.
The surname O'Ceallaigh is most frequently occurring in Ireland, where it is borne by 148 people, or 1 in 31,817. In Ireland it is most prevalent in: Leinster, where 55 percent reside, Munster, where 23 percent reside and Connaught, where 22 percent reside. Besides Ireland this last name exists in 9 countries. It is also found in The United States, where 8 percent reside and Northern Ireland, where 7 percent reside.
O'Ceallaigh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The frequency of O'Ceallaigh has changed over time. In Ireland the number of people carrying the O'Ceallaigh last name expanded 4,933 percent between 1901 and 2014.
